Union County STR License # 015472 This hidden gem is Conveniently located between downtown Blairsville and Blue Ridge, Georgia. Enjoy the unique view of forest and farm while overlooking horses grazing and large mountain pond. This cabin offers two king suites, spa like master bath, fully stocked kitchen, gas fireplace, paved fire pit, hot-tub coming February 2022, outdoor gas grill, 3 new smart TVs with streaming services, hi-speed wifi, Samsung washer and dryer, and the comfiest bedding in town! One mile to Lake Nottley.

About the area
Blairsville
Located in Blairsville, this cabin is in a rural area and on the waterfront. Odom Springs Vineyards and Old Union Golf Course are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those in the mood for shopping can visit Union County Farmers Market and Victoria's Center. Village Boutique and Tank Town USA are also worth visiting. Kayaking and water tubing off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hiking/biking trails and mountain biking nearby.
